NYCPlanning / labs-factfinder

New York City Census Reporting Tool
Other
40 stars 12 forks source link

Need better MapboxGL load state visuals #278

Open allthesignals opened 6 years ago

allthesignals commented 6 years ago

This is difficult to reproduce, but under degraded network speed conditions (both in terms of Carto API response time and user network speed), toggling across summary levels produces strange behavior. For example, selecting an NTA, generating a report, then switching back can produce a situation in which only a single geometry is visible on the map because the NTA geographies layer hasn't loaded yet.

We should build more sophisticated loading state.

andycochran commented 6 years ago

This may relate to toggling choropleths too. We could have a spinner on the map any time it's thinking.